Bright Line Law is a barrister law firm providing specialist advisory, advocacy, litigation, policy and strategic services in all aspects of financial crime cases. The firm was established by Jonathan Fisher QC, one of the UK’s leading barristers in white collar crime cases. Bright Line Law’s work is supported by associates who practised as solicitors and subsequently cross-qualified as barristers. Bright Line Law is based in the heart of London, one of the world’s financial hubs, and advises leading organisations and SMEs operating in the financial and business sphere on all kinds of financial wrongdoing and corporate investigations. Its service is tailor made to each of its clients, taking into consideration their specific needs with a view to achieving the best outcome for them at every opportunity. Jonathan Fisher QC is ranked by the internationally recognised law directory, Chambers & Partners UK, as a leading barrister in Band 1 for Financial Crime and Proceeds of Crime cases. He is also ranked in the legal directories as a leading barrister for financial services, fraud and tax cases. With extensive experience in civil, criminal and regulatory cases, Jonathan has been instructed in many of the UK’s leading financial

Bright Line Law is based in the heart of London. crime cases. He has advised and represented many individuals and companies, as well as government agencies such as the Serious Fraud Office, the Crown Prosecution Service and HM Revenue & Customs. Much of the work involves cross-border transactions, offshore companies and trusts. Jonathan has been described in the legal directories as “high-flying”, “a standout barrister”, “having great gravitas … where the stakes are high”, “calm, sure, and deadly at spotting the weaknesses of the opponent’s case”, “judges defer to his knowledge”, and “in a game of chess, he would be five steps ahead.” Bright Line Law was recognised by the Financial Times Innovative Lawyers Awards in 2017 as “standout for driving value for clients”. It was also highly commended for services to the rule of law and access to justice, and Jonathan was listed as one of 10 innovative lawyers.

Rosenblatt Group plc is a professional legal services company, which includes one of the UK’s leading dispute resolution practices. We provide a range of legal services to our diversified client base, which includes companies, banks, entrepreneurs and individuals. Complementing this is the Group’s increasingly international footprint, advising on complex cross-jurisdictional cases, for example, in China, Israel, America and India. Rosenblatt’s practice areas cover dispute resolution, corporate, banking and finance, insolvency and financial restructuring, construction and projects, employment, financial services, IP/technology/ media, real estate, regulatory and tax. Established in the City of London in 1989, central to every relationship that we build is a firm commitment to our clients’ success.
